MySQL是一种流行的关系型数据库管理系统(RDBMS),广泛应用于各种Web应用程序和服务器中,用于存储和管理数据。Ubuntu是一个基于Debian的开源操作系统,广泛用于服务器和个人计算机。
如果你需要在Ubuntu系统上重新安装MySQL,可以按照以下步骤操作:
首先,你需要卸载系统中现有的MySQL服务器。打开终端并执行以下命令:
sudo apt-get remove --purge mysql-server mysql-client mysql-common
sudo apt-get autoremove
sudo apt-get autoclean
卸载MySQL后,可能会有一些残留的数据目录和配置文件,你可以使用以下命令来清理它们:
sudo rm -rf /var/lib/mysql
sudo rm -rf /etc/mysql
在安装新的MySQL之前,更新你的软件包列表以确保你获取的是最新版本:
sudo apt-get update
现在你可以安装MySQL服务器了:
sudo apt-get install mysql-server
在安装过程中,系统会提示你设置MySQL的root用户密码。
安装完成后,启动MySQL服务并检查其状态:
sudo systemctl start mysql
sudo systemctl status mysql
如果MySQL服务成功启动,你应该会看到类似于“Active: active (running)”的状态信息。
MySQL适用于多种应用场景,包括但不限于:
原因:可能是由于某些软件包的版本不兼容或者依赖关系未满足。
解决方法:
sudo apt-get install -f
这个命令会尝试修复依赖关系问题。
原因:可能是由于配置文件错误、权限问题或其他系统问题。
解决方法:
检查MySQL的错误日志,通常位于/var/log/mysql/error.log
。根据日志中的错误信息进行相应的修复。
例如,如果日志中提到权限问题,可以尝试更改数据目录的权限:
sudo chown -R mysql:mysql /var/lib/mysql
sudo chmod -R 755 /var/lib/mysql
然后重新启动MySQL服务。
如果你在使用腾讯云服务器上遇到问题,可以考虑使用腾讯云提供的MySQL服务,具体信息可以在腾讯云官网找到:腾讯云MySQL
领取专属 10元无门槛券
手把手带您无忧上云